This is a War (board game) version for multi-agent system. The agents decide who to attack and who to make alliances with. The game ends when there's only one player with territories.

System architecture

The map is a graph and each territory is a node.

Agents have the following behaviours:

- Attacks randomly
- Choose territories with highest difference in number of troops. Sometimes decide to not attack at all
